One killed, 4 hurt in West Bank

The shooting threatened to inflame tensions in the West Bank, where Jewish settlers and Palestinians live in uneasy proximity and where settlers have responded to attacks in the past with violent reprisals.

Police identified the dead as Ben-Yosef Livnat, a Jerusalem resident. Israeli media reported that Livnat was the nephew of Limor Livnat, a prominent hardline Cabinet minister from the ruling Likud Party.

Livnat, who attended the funeral, said her nephew was killed by a “terrorist disguised as a Palestinian policeman.”

Ben-Yosef Livnat and several companions entered the Palestinian city of Nablus early on Sunday to visit a site known as Joseph’s Tomb. Jewish worshippers regularly enter the city with a special military escort to pray at a building traditionally identified as the gravesite of the biblical Joseph, located inside a Palestinian-ruled area.
